Unhappy ultra racing 4pt rear bar clearance problem

I went to install my ultra racing 4pt rear bar today on my gd3 and my exhaust is in the way. I have a ASPEC mid pipe. The mounting flange is about an inch away from the under body when it hits the exhaust Any one else ever have this issue before?
